网站占用服务器是什么意思?网站和服务器的关系是什么?
卡尔云官网
www.kaeryun.com
在当今互联网时代,网站的运作离不开服务器的支持,很多人对网站和服务器的关系不是很清楚,尤其是刚接触网络的朋友,网站占用服务器是什么意思呢?服务器又具体占用了哪些资源呢?今天我们就来详细了解一下。
服务器是什么?
服务器,英文是Server,是一台用于存储数据、处理请求的计算机,服务器就像一个大仓库,专门用来存放和管理网站上的数据,比如图片、文字、视频等,都会存储在服务器上供用户访问。
服务器的作用主要可以分为以下几个方面:
- 存储数据:网站上的所有内容,如网页代码、图片、视频等,都需要存储在服务器上。
- 处理请求:当用户通过浏览器访问网站时,浏览器会向服务器发送请求,服务器会根据请求返回相应的页面。
- 提供服务:服务器还负责处理各种服务请求,比如支付、订单处理等。
网站和服务器的关系
网站和服务器的关系就像一棵大树和它的根系一样,缺一不可,网站需要服务器来提供服务,而服务器也需要网站来为其提供服务。
-
网站为服务器提供服务:
- 存储服务:网站需要存储大量的数据,服务器负责提供存储空间。
- 计算服务:网站需要运行复杂的程序和算法,服务器负责提供计算资源。
- 安全服务:网站需要保护用户的数据和隐私,服务器负责提供安全措施。
-
服务器为网站提供支持:
- 硬件支持:服务器需要高性能的硬件设备,如处理器、内存、存储设备等。
- 软件支持:服务器需要运行专门的软件,如操作系统、数据库管理系统等。
- 网络支持:服务器需要连接到互联网,才能为网站提供服务。
网站占用服务器的原因
网站占用服务器主要是因为网站需要运行各种功能和程序,网站占用服务器的原因可以总结为以下几点:
-
服务器资源有限: 每台服务器都有一定的资源限制,比如CPU、内存、存储等,如果网站的需求超过了服务器的资源限制,服务器就需要占用更多的资源来满足需求。
-
网站功能复杂: 现代网站通常需要运行多种功能,比如静态页面生成、数据库管理、支付系统等,这些功能都需要消耗服务器的资源。
-
数据存储需求: 网站需要存储大量的数据,如图片、视频、用户信息等,这些数据需要占用服务器的存储空间。
-
带宽消耗: 网站需要向用户发送响应内容,这需要消耗带宽,如果带宽不足,服务器就需要占用更多的资源来处理请求。
如何减少网站对服务器的占用?
了解了网站占用服务器的原因,我们也可以采取一些措施来减少这种占用,从而提高服务器的运行效率,以下是一些实用的建议:
-
优化网站代码:
- 使用压缩和优化工具,如Gzip和Minify,来减少网站的体积。
- 使用CDN(内容分发网络)来加速网站内容的加载速度,减少对带宽的消耗。
-
使用轻量级框架:
- 选择轻量级的前端框架,如Svelte或Vite,可以减少服务器的负担。
- 使用静态生成器,如Gatsby或Vercel,生成静态页面,减少对动态资源的依赖。
-
合理配置服务器资源:
- 根据网站的需求,合理配置服务器的CPU、内存和存储等资源。
- 使用弹性伸缩技术,根据负载自动调整服务器的数量。
-
使用云服务:
如果自己搭建服务器比较复杂,可以考虑使用云服务提供商,如AWS、GCP或阿里云,这些服务已经优化了服务器资源的使用效率。
网站占用服务器是现代互联网中再正常不过的现象,服务器为网站提供存储、计算和安全等多方面的支持,而网站则为服务器提供存储、计算和带宽等资源,了解网站和服务器的关系,可以帮助我们更好地管理和优化网站的运行。
通过优化网站代码、选择轻量级框架、合理配置服务器资源等方法,我们可以减少网站对服务器的占用,提高服务器的运行效率,为网站的持续发展提供保障。
卡尔云官网
www.kaeryun.com